Transaction 04bc6362867b1a2899351ce82191b4b30ee75bde6f6aed41df5c3b7c0e1beab7
1 Input
1 Output
-
04bc6362867b1a2899351ce82191b4b30ee75bde6f6aed41df5c3b7c0e1beab7:0
- value
- 2011848
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d778348920d18bd575e25bb6511654ae3fb6a481 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LeJHFQqmeeNPMeqz95S9a8G7zWB6kdrk6